/* line 78, framework/resources/css/icons.scss */
img.loading {
  padding-left: 10px; }

/* line 83, framework/resources/css/icons.scss */
a.accept span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/accept.png"); }

/* line 88, framework/resources/css/icons.scss */
a.search span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/magnifier.png"); }

/* line 93, framework/resources/css/icons.scss */
a.prev span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/resultset_previous.png"); }

/* line 98, framework/resources/css/icons.scss */
a.next span.text {
  background-position: 100% 50%;
  padding-left: 0;
  padding-right: 20px;
  background-image: url("/Framework/Resources/Images/Icons/silk/resultset_next.png"); }

/* line 106, framework/resources/css/icons.scss */
a.more span.text {
  background-position: 100% 55%;
  background-repeat: no-repeat;
  padding-left: 0;
  padding-right: 10px;
  background-image: url("/Framework/Resources/Images/Icons/arrow_right.png"); }

/* line 115, framework/resources/css/icons.scss */
a.less span.text {
  background-position: 100% 50%;
  background-repeat: no-repeat;
  padding-left: 0;
  padding-right: 10px;
  background-image: url("/Framework/Resources/Images/Icons/arrow_down.png"); }

/* line 124, framework/resources/css/icons.scss */
a.save span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/disk.png"); }

/* line 129, framework/resources/css/icons.scss */
a.cancel span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/cancel.png"); }

/* line 134, framework/resources/css/icons.scss */
a.excel span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/page_excel.png"); }

/* line 139, framework/resources/css/icons.scss */
a.pdf span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/page_pdf.png"); }

/* line 144, framework/resources/css/icons.scss */
a.print span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/printer.png"); }

/* line 149, framework/resources/css/icons.scss */
a.undo span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/arrow_undo.png"); }

/* line 154, framework/resources/css/icons.scss */
a.redo span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/arrow_redo.png"); }

/* line 159, framework/resources/css/icons.scss */
a.add span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/add.png"); }

/* line 164, framework/resources/css/icons.scss */
a.delete span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/delete.png"); }

/* line 169, framework/resources/css/icons.scss */
a.spell-check span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/spellcheck.png"); }

/* line 174, framework/resources/css/icons.scss */
a.more,
a.less {
  text-decoration: none; }

/* line 180, framework/resources/css/icons.scss */
a.save-mini span.text {
  background-image: url("/Framework/Resources/Images/Icons/diagona-mini/save.png"); }

/* line 185, framework/resources/css/icons.scss */
a.cancel-mini span.text {
  background-image: url("/Framework/Resources/Images/Icons/diagona-mini/cancel.png"); }

/* line 190, framework/resources/css/icons.scss */
a.undo-mini span.text {
  background-image: url("/Framework/Resources/Images/Icons/diagona-mini/undo.png"); }

/* line 195, framework/resources/css/icons.scss */
a.print-mini span.text {
  background-image: url("/Framework/Resources/Images/Icons/diagona-mini/print.png"); }

/* line 200, framework/resources/css/icons.scss */
a.excel-mini span.text {
  background-image: url("/Framework/Resources/Images/Icons/diagona-mini/excel.png"); }

/* line 205, framework/resources/css/icons.scss */
a.renew-all-mini span.text {
  background-image: url("/Framework/Resources/Images/Icons/diagona-mini/save.png"); }

/* line 210, framework/resources/css/icons.scss */
a.up-arrow span.text {
  background-position: 100% 55%;
  background-repeat: no-repeat;
  padding-left: 0;
  padding-right: 10px;
  background-image: url("/Framework/Resources/Images/Icons/silk/arrow_up.png"); }

/* line 219, framework/resources/css/icons.scss */
a.down-arrow span.text {
  background-position: 100% 55%;
  background-repeat: no-repeat;
  padding-left: 0;
  padding-right: 10px;
  background-image: url("/Framework/Resources/Images/Icons/silk/arrow_down.png"); }

/* line 228, framework/resources/css/icons.scss */
a.left-arrow span.text {
  background-position: 100% 55%;
  background-repeat: no-repeat;
  padding-left: 0;
  padding-right: 10px;
  background-image: url("/Framework/Resources/Images/Icons/silk/arrow_left.png"); }

/* line 237, framework/resources/css/icons.scss */
a.right-arrow span.text {
  background-position: 100% 55%;
  background-repeat: no-repeat;
  padding-left: 0;
  padding-right: 10px;
  background-image: url("/Framework/Resources/Images/Icons/silk/arrow_right.png"); }

/* line 246, framework/resources/css/icons.scss */
a.sort-asc {
  padding-right: 12px;
  background: url("/Framework/Resources/Images/Icons/sort_up.png") no-repeat 100% 50%; }

/* line 252, framework/resources/css/icons.scss */
a.sort-desc {
  padding-right: 12px;
  background: url("/Framework/Resources/Images/Icons/sort_down.png") no-repeat 100% 50%; }

/* line 10, Controls/LoadingAnimation */
div.loading-animation {
  display: -moz-inline-stack;
  display: inline-block;
  zoom: 1;
  *display: inline;
  height: 32px;
  width: 32px;
  background: url("/Framework/Resources/Images/Icons/loading.gif"); }
  /* line 15, Controls/LoadingAnimation */
  div.loading-animation span {
    display: none; }

/* line 20, Controls/LoadingAnimation */
div.loading-animation-small {
  display: -moz-inline-stack;
  display: inline-block;
  zoom: 1;
  *display: inline;
  height: 16px;
  width: 16px;
  background: url("/Framework/Resources/Images/Icons/loading_sm.gif"); }
  /* line 25, Controls/LoadingAnimation */
  div.loading-animation-small span {
    display: none; }

/* line 260, framework/resources/css/icons.scss */
a.add-friend span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/add.png"); }

/* line 265, framework/resources/css/icons.scss */
a.remove-friend span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/delete.png"); }

/* line 270, framework/resources/css/icons.scss */
a.my-profile span.text {
  background-image: url("/Framework/Resources/Images/Icons/silk/user.png"); }

/* line 275, framework/resources/css/icons.scss */
a.delete-button {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/x_button.png"); }

/* line 284, framework/resources/css/icons.scss */
a.delete-button span.text {
  display: none; }

/* line 289, framework/resources/css/icons.scss */
a.delete-button:link,
a.delete-button:visited {
  opacity: 0.667; }

/* line 295, framework/resources/css/icons.scss */
a.delete-button:hover,
a.delete-button:active {
  opacity: 1.0; }

/* line 301, framework/resources/css/icons.scss */
a.edit-icon {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/pencil.png"); }

/* line 310, framework/resources/css/icons.scss */
a.edit-icon span.text {
  display: none; }

/* line 315, framework/resources/css/icons.scss */
a.delete-icon {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/cross.png"); }

/* line 324, framework/resources/css/icons.scss */
a.delete-icon span.text {
  display: none; }

/* line 329, framework/resources/css/icons.scss */
a.add-icon {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/add.png"); }

/* line 338, framework/resources/css/icons.scss */
a.add-icon span.text {
  display: none; }

/* line 343, framework/resources/css/icons.scss */
a.subtract-icon {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/delete.png"); }

/* line 352, framework/resources/css/icons.scss */
a.subtract-icon span.text {
  display: none; }

/* line 357, framework/resources/css/icons.scss */
a.header-x {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/white-x.png"); }

/* line 366, framework/resources/css/icons.scss */
a.header-x span.text {
  display: none; }

/* line 371, framework/resources/css/icons.scss */
a.import-rule-edit {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/page_edit.png"); }

/* line 380, framework/resources/css/icons.scss */
a.import-rule-edit span.text {
  display: none; }

/* line 385, framework/resources/css/icons.scss */
a.import-rule-delete {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/cross.png"); }

/* line 394, framework/resources/css/icons.scss */
a.import-rule-delete span.text {
  display: none; }

/* line 399, framework/resources/css/icons.scss */
a.import-rule-copy {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/page_copy.png"); }

/* line 408, framework/resources/css/icons.scss */
a.import-rule-copy span.text {
  display: none; }

/* line 413, framework/resources/css/icons.scss */
a.import-group-edit {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/folder_edit.png"); }

/* line 422, framework/resources/css/icons.scss */
a.import-group-edit span.text {
  display: none; }

/* line 427, framework/resources/css/icons.scss */
a.import-group-copy {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/page_copy.png"); }

/* line 436, framework/resources/css/icons.scss */
a.import-group-copy span.text {
  display: none; }

/* line 441, framework/resources/css/icons.scss */
a.import-group-delete {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/cross.png"); }

/* line 450, framework/resources/css/icons.scss */
a.import-group-delete span.text {
  display: none; }

/* line 455, framework/resources/css/icons.scss */
a.import-group-unapply {
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/silk/folder_delete.png"); }

/* line 464, framework/resources/css/icons.scss */
a.import-group-unapply span.text {
  display: none; }

/* line 469, framework/resources/css/icons.scss */
a.import-group-create {
  background-position: top left;
  background-repeat: no-repeat;
  background-image: url("/Framework/Resources/Images/Icons/silk/folder_add.png"); }

/* line 476, framework/resources/css/icons.scss */
a.import-rule-create {
  background-position: top left;
  background-repeat: no-repeat;
  background-image: url("/Framework/Resources/Images/Icons/silk/bricks.png"); }

/* line 483, framework/resources/css/icons.scss */
a.import-rule-subscribe {
  background-position: top left;
  background-repeat: no-repeat;
  background-image: url("/Framework/Resources/Images/Icons/silk/page_white_link.png"); }

/* line 490, framework/resources/css/icons.scss */
a.import-group-apply {
  background-position: top left;
  background-repeat: no-repeat;
  background-image: url("/Framework/Resources/Images/Icons/silk/folder_add.png"); }

/* line 497, framework/resources/css/icons.scss */
a.import-group-pre {
  background-position: top left;
  background-repeat: no-repeat;
  background-image: url("/Framework/Resources/Images/Icons/folder_red.png"); }

/* line 504, framework/resources/css/icons.scss */
a.import-group-post {
  background-position: top left;
  background-repeat: no-repeat;
  background-image: url("/Framework/Resources/Images/Icons/silk/folder.png"); }

/* line 511, framework/resources/css/icons.scss */
a.strikeout-icon {
  background-position: -16px 0px;
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/VehicleDetails/eye-icons.png"); }

/* line 521, framework/resources/css/icons.scss */
a.strikeout-icon:hover {
  background-position: 0px -16px; }

/* line 526, framework/resources/css/icons.scss */
a.strikeout-icon span.text {
  display: none; }

/* line 531, framework/resources/css/icons.scss */
a.unstrikeout-icon {
  background-position: 0px 0px;
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/VehicleDetails/eye-icons.png"); }

/* line 541, framework/resources/css/icons.scss */
a.unstrikeout-icon:hover {
  background-position: -16px -16px; }

/* line 546, framework/resources/css/icons.scss */
a.unstrikeout-icon span.text {
  display: none; }

/* line 551, framework/resources/css/icons.scss */
a.highlight-icon {
  background-position: -16px 0px;
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/VehicleDetails/star.png"); }

/* line 561, framework/resources/css/icons.scss */
a.highlight-icon:hover {
  background-position: 0px -16px; }

/* line 566, framework/resources/css/icons.scss */
a.highlight-icon span.text {
  display: none; }

/* line 571, framework/resources/css/icons.scss */
a.unhighlight-icon {
  background-position: 0px 0px;
  font-size: 1px;
  height: 16px;
  padding-left: 16px;
  width: 0px;
  background-image: url("/Framework/Resources/Images/Icons/VehicleDetails/star.png"); }

/* line 581, framework/resources/css/icons.scss */
a.unhighlight-icon:hover {
  background-position: 0px -16px; }

/* line 586, framework/resources/css/icons.scss */
a.unhighlight-icon span.text {
  display: none; }

/* line 591, framework/resources/css/icons.scss */
span.led-light-green {
  background-repeat: no-repeat;
  display: inline-block;
  font-size: 1px;
  height: 16px;
  vertical-align: middle;
  width: 16px;
  background-image: url("/Framework/Resources/Images/Icons/led_green.png"); }

/* line 602, framework/resources/css/icons.scss */
span.led-light-orange {
  background-repeat: no-repeat;
  display: inline-block;
  font-size: 1px;
  height: 16px;
  vertical-align: middle;
  width: 16px;
  background-image: url("/Framework/Resources/Images/Icons/led_orange.png"); }

/* line 613, framework/resources/css/icons.scss */
span.led-light-red {
  background-repeat: no-repeat;
  display: inline-block;
  font-size: 1px;
  height: 16px;
  vertical-align: middle;
  width: 16px;
  background-image: url("/Framework/Resources/Images/Icons/led_red.png"); }

/***********************************************************************************************
  Extra From Skin
 ***********************************************************************************************/
/* Extra From Skin */
/* line 629, framework/resources/css/icons.scss */
.external {
  background: url("/Framework/Resources/Images/Icons/external-link.png") no-repeat 100% 50%;
  padding-right: 14px; }
